"Tenere-Killer"? Die neue Voge DS800 Rally

The Voge DS 800 Rally, with its 21"/18" wheels and a chassis designed for tough use, is clearly positioned for the Dakar. At its heart is a newly developed 798 cc inline twin-cylinder engine producing 95 hp at 9,000 rpm and 81 Nm of torque at 6,500 rpm, a 6-speed transmission, quickshifter, and slipper clutch. Add to that a 24-liter fuel tank, 213 kg, an 845 mm seat height, and 220 mm ground clearance. The DS 800 Rally's chassis features fully adjustable KYB components (200 mm USD fork, 190 mm monoshock) and tubeless spoked rims fitted with factory-fitted Pirelli Scorpion Rally STR tires. Braking is provided by a Nissin dual-disc brake system (305mm/265mm), and ABS and traction control can be deactivated for off-road use. A steering damper that can be adjusted on the fly is standard, as is a TFT display with smartphone connectivity, navigation, and tire pressure monitoring. The heated grips and seat are almost a luxury in this class. The 21/18-inch enduro chassis allows for serious off-road tires, which is also supported by the suspension travel reserves and the switchable assistance systems. The 24-liter fuel tank capacity and the comfort features will naturally also appeal to touring riders.
